Today’s Challenges

1) Today’s rate environment means tighter margins and reduced profitability from traditional banking

1. Do you have the data and tools to manage your margins on a daily basis and understand the drivers behind changes?

2. Can you provide employees real-time insight into their performance and how it is trending vs. company targets?

3. Do you wonder how to increase your cross-sell ratio or which products to market to different customers?

4. Are you maximizing your potential for noninterest income to supplement income from reduced margins?

2) Managing and understanding risk throughout the organization has become more important than ever

1. Does your entire organization from the board to branch managers have insight into the various types of risk (credit, operational, liquidity, etc.) that each of them manage and whether they are within company thresholds?

2. On a daily basis, can you see where credit risk is concentrated and drill down to the customers driving the risk?

3. Can you easily demonstrate to your regulators how you are managing risk throughout the organization?

3) With increased regulatory demands and continued economic challenges, community banks are forced to operate as efficiently as possible and do more with less

1. Are you spending more time preparing reports and statistics for the board, ALCO meetings, regulators, auditors, and others than actually analyzing the data?

2. Do you struggle to get the right data on branch efficiency and whether they can improve?

3. Would you like more data on how customers interact with your bank and how that impacts expenses & revenue?
